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3116970 34584624 58 242287
953642 62748363047 71837610144
953642 62748363047 71837610144
7975 409813236 54 81 83
All about undefined
Interested in learning more?
953642 62748363047 71837610144
7975 409813236 54 81 83
See more
5878559862 01111
220999913 849 52778952 549
See more
4556 5273790
48 8198831862 560474 624
See more